Answer:

13

Explanation:

To solve this problem, we need to use the substitution method - because we are given a value for x and asked to evaluate the expression.

Evaluate 3x - 2; x = 5

1. Substitute 5 in for x in the expression

3(5) - 2

2. Multiply

15 - 2

3. Subtract

13
